#dc09d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c09dc is composed of 86.3% red, 3.5%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 44.9%. #dc09d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12ff with #b900b9.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#dc09d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c09dc has RGB values of R:220, G:9,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14420444.

Shades and Tints of #dc09d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d010d is the darkest color, while #fff9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c09d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b6a7b is the less saturated color, while #e500e5 is the most saturated one.
